... Read moreVisiting the Legion of Honor offers a truly immersive experience for anyone who appreciates art and history. The museum’s architecture, inspired by the French neoclassical style, instantly transports visitors to a European palace setting. Inside, the collection showcases a wide array of European artworks, including paintings, sculptures, and decorative arts spanning centuries. One of the highlights for me was the serene garden area outside the museum, which creates a perfect backdrop for photos and quiet reflection. The views of the Golden Gate Bridge just a short walk away add a unique San Francisco flair, blending natural beauty with cultural richness. I found the museum to be excellent for spending a leisurely day. Whether you’re an art enthusiast or just looking for a peaceful spot to unwind, the Legion of Honor provides both inspiration and relaxation. Also, it’s a great location for fashion and outfit photos due to the elegant surroundings and natural light. If you plan your visit during off-peak hours or weekdays, you can enjoy the exhibits without the crowds, making it easier to appreciate the masterpieces in a calm environment. Don’t miss the Adolph B. and Alma de Bretteville Spreckels Gallery, which houses some of the most exquisite pieces. Overall, the Legion of Honor offers a perfect blend of cultural immersion and stunning visuals that feel like a little corner of Europe in the heart of San Francisco.
